Click stuffing is a fraud technique used primarily in affiliate marketing and display advertising where fraudsters secretly load multiple ad clicks into a single page visit. When a user visits a website, hidden iframes fire clicks across multiple advertisers' ads simultaneously. If that user subsequently makes a purchase from any of those advertisers, the fraudulent click receives the attribution credit — stealing commission from the legitimate channel that actually drove the conversion.
For advertisers running last-click attribution models, click stuffing is especially damaging because it silently redirects commission payouts away from the channels that genuinely earned the sale. Over time, this inflates the apparent performance of affiliate and display channels, causing budget to shift toward sources that are generating no incremental value.

Detect hidden click injection patterns
Tapper identifies the signature patterns of click stuffing — multiple simultaneous click events from a single session, hidden iframe activity, and attribution timestamps that precede plausible user journeys.
02
Validate click-to-conversion paths
Each conversion is traced back through its attributed click path. Conversions where the attributed click shows stuffing characteristics are flagged before commission payouts are approved.
03
Restore accurate attribution
With click stuffing removed, attribution credit flows to the channels that genuinely drove your conversions, giving you accurate data to allocate budget and assess partner performance.
